Output 22c7898290edd416a16d6b12084280839b9c25d076e9e261d8ea863587818b6d:43

value
31831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a07d85fea198385d6915377aeb5fa4287cafe6 OP_EQUAL
address
3MSS93R5Ejrp3HyQQYyhKXEE1z63XomjNV
transaction
22c7898290edd416a16d6b12084280839b9c25d076e9e261d8ea863587818b6d
spent
true